This file includes two different types of Volunteer Logs and instructions.

Print as many as you need! In the file you will find:

• INDIVIDUAL VOLUNTEER LOG – Used for a single individual logging many hours for the same agency or project. Volunteer tracks his or her own hours and calculates an individual total on each sheet.

• GROUP/EVENT VOLUNTEER LOG – Used when many volunteers are working at an event, for example, a food distribution. Each volunteer signs in and out and hours are calculated for each volunteer and totaled at the bottom. Use as many sheets as necessary.

Accurately tracking volunteer hours is an importance piece of the disaster recovery efforts.  If volunteer services are recorded properly, we may be able to apply volunteer hours towards the state’s share of recovery cost.
